Meta adds 14 free Messenger video games.

Meta’s Facebook Gaming subsidiary is making Messenger video conversations more fun with a new series of free-to-play games you can play with friends anywhere. The function is late in the post-covid lockdown era but perfect for fast Words with Friends, Mini Golf FRVR, and Exploding Kittens sessions (via Engadget).

Facebook users love the new Messenger video call gaming feature’s accessibility. Start a video conference with one or more people, press the group mode button in the middle, click the Play icon, and choose a game from the library—no downloading or installation necessary.

In 2018, Facebook announced an AR games feature in Messenger that allows up to six friends to get on a call and play games like Don’t Smile, encouraging friends not to smile. This deployment brings in genuine mobile games that are already thriving outside Messenger.

iOS, Android, and web users may now play Messenger video call games. As Facebook Gaming encourages developers to add functionality to their games, additional titles are expected. Most of the 14 games in the library only require two players.

Video calls are a fun way to chat with friends while playing games, but many platforms don’t make it easy to start one without using two services or a Drawful event. So be ready for your aunts to play Fish over the video.
